Proman Stena Bulk takes delivery of second methanol-fuelled tanker Stena Pro Marine.
Proman Stena Bulk is a joint venture (JV) between global methanol producer Proman and one of the world’s largest tanker shipping companies Stena Bulk.
Both 49,990 DWT IMOIIMeMAX dual-fuel mid-range (MR) tankers were built at GSI in China. Stena Pro Marine, like Stena Pro Patria, is expected to consume 12,500 tonnes of methanol per annum.
Stena Pro Marine delivery came following the delivery of Stena Pro Patria in June, which was the first methanol-powered newbuild vessel delivered by Guangzhou Shipyard International Co Ltd (GSI).
Four additional JV and Proman vessels are also due for delivery by 2024.
